Seek Help in the Highest Hill. When the hills in your life look like the solution to your pain or the source of your affliction, the psalmist teaches us to look elsewhere for our help. We look with spiritual eyes to the heavenly hill of Zion, the dwelling place of the Lord. “My help comes from the Lord, who made heaven and earth” (Psalm 121:2).

I WILL lift up mine eyes unto the hills, from whence cometh my help. 2 My help cometh from the LORD, which made heaven and earth. 3 He will not suffer thy foot to be moved: he that keepeth thee will not slumber. 4 Behold, he that keepeth Israel shall neither slumber nor sleep. 5 The LORD is thy keeper: the LORD is thy shade upon they ...No; my confidence is in God only. Or, we must lift up our eyes above the hills; we must look to God who makes all earthly things to us what they are. We must see all our help in God; from him we must expect it, in his own way and time. This psalm teaches us to comfort ourselves in the Lord, when difficulties and dangers are greatest.My help, my help, my help All of my help cometh from the Lord I will lift up mine eyes to the hills From whence cometh my help My help cometh from the Lord The Lord which made Heaven and earth He said He will not suffer thy foot Thy foot to be moved, The Lord that keepeth thee He will not slumber nor sleep For the Lord is thy keeper The Lord is ...

In these first words of one of the greatest Psalms of David, the nobleness which we immediately feel seems to lie in this, that David will seek help only from the highest source. Nothing less than God's help can really meet his needs.My Help (Cometh From The Lord) (Written by Jackie Gouche Farris) (Recorded by Ron Winans & Family and Friends Choir, Bam Crawford, and also The Brooklyn Tabernacle Choir) Verse: I will lift up mine eyes to the hills From whence cometh my help, My help cometh from the Lord, The Lord which made Heaven and Earth.
